INGREDIENTS
4 boneless, skin on chicken breast
3 large apples- any variety
1 white onion
4 cups of fresh spinach or 1/2 box frozen chopped spinach
1 small package Boursin cheese
1/4 cup white whine
1/4 cup toasted breadcrumbs
4 tablespoons butter
Salt, pepper, vegetable oil

Method
Medium Dice the onion and apples. Sauté with butter until soft and Caramelized, deglaze with white wine and reduce. Add in spinach and remove from heat and wilt spinach. Transfer to a bowl and cool. Mix in breadcrumbs and Boursin cheese. Season as needed with salt and pepper.
Create a pocket hole in the chicken breast with a pairing or boning knife. Place Stuffing mix into a piping bag and stuff each chicken breast. Sear chicken breast in hot sauté pan with a little oil until brown. Finish cooking in the oven until the chicken is cooked Through, About 10 minutes.

Sauce
2 cups apple cider
2 cups chicken stock
2 tablespoons whole grain mustard

Place ingredients in sauce pot and cook to reduce to the liquid by half. Season as needed.
